About the Book

Healing is possible -- discover life after losing your unborn or newly born child

Do you feel that the hurt and anguish after losing your unborn is on a completely new level you didn't imagine possible?

Do you feel that nobody around you understands the extent of your emotions, nor the importance of your lost child to you?

Do you feel tortured that your child is passing unnoticed, and fear they might be forever forgotten?

These are the feelings of every mother who has experienced a miscarriage, stillbirth, or infant death.

At times, you may feel your grief is beyond overcoming -- that this feeling will never come to an end.

You will never forget your lost child, and the pain you are experiencing now may turn into fear and anxiety in your next pregnancy.

10-15% of pregnancies end in miscarriage, and 1 in 250 pregnancies end in stillbirth.

These astonishing numbers of child loss may not reduce your suffering, but they do tell you that you're not alone -- despite the silence around your loss.

By now you know that only a mother who has been through what you are going through can fully understand you.

Ashlyn Baker was in your shoes, and she is here to help you through the healing process she went through and helped others fulfill.

She offers you practical ways to recover and treasure your child with meaningful acts that will make their shortened life significant and impactful.

In Losing a Part of Me, you will discover:

  • 16 ways to cherish your lost child and keep their memory alive
  • The stories of mothers who went through your invisible pain to finally feel understood
  • The incomparable impact miscarriage, stillbirth, or infant death may have on you -- and how to embrace it rather than lose yourself along the way
  • When and how to consider another pregnancy and await your future baby
  • The aspects of your particular grief and the bereavement process you're experiencing -- accept that there is nothing wrong with you
  • How to understand your family's grief to keep your marriage strong and protect your family
  • 20+ advices to ensure a successful healing journey, no matter where you currently are in the process

And much more.

It's time to stop feeling shadowed and isolated. Find the experience you can identify with and the specific support you need to process your grief.

Overcome the confusion and bewilderment you are in to finally feel seen and accepted.

The captured echoes of your own thoughts and feelings will give you much-needed peace, especially when you have the resources to find comfort, hope, and resilience.
